Collectors and megafans also have some extraREcontent to look forward to with the forthcoming release of a limited edition Nemesis figure developed by Numskull Designs in conjunction with Capcom.Numskull Designs has had a hand in some particularly stellar stuff of late; anepic recreation ofDestiny’s Lord Shaxxwas revealed in June and was followed by the confirmation of an adorableDestiny 2hive worm plush. The merchandise manufacturer is also known for the TUBBZ Cosplaying Ducks figurine line, which saw the once-menacingResident Evilvillains Mr. X and William Birkin transformed into adorable bath buddies.RELATED:Dead By Daylight Leak Reveals Possible Resident Evil Killer And SurvivorsThe upcoming Nemesis figure, which is now available for pre-order on the Numskull Designs site, is based on the antagonist’s reimagined visage seen in the 2020 remake ofResident Evil 3. Immaculately detailed and sporting his iconic heat-seeking rocket launcher, this 10.9-inch figure looks to be the stuff of nightmares—andResident Evilmost fans likely wouldn’t have it any other way.
Numskull actually released a similar model that coincided with the tremendous remake ofResident Evil 2in 2019. The 6.5-inch hand-painted figure depicted a licker, one of the game’s most fearsome enemies, and it retailed for just shy of one hundred dollars. That may seem like a steep sum to non-collectors, but the quality of Numskull Designs’ work isn’t to be underestimated; it’s tough to imagine more lifelike or lovingly-rendered officialResident Evilmerchandisethan what Numskull has on offer.
Numskull also dabbled with other survival horror franchises, releasing some wickedlywell-realizedSilent Hillfigures in 2021. Replicas of the infamous nurses seen in the first three titles, these bobbleheads actually partially imitated the disturbingly dexterous movements of the in-game enemies, adding a whole new level of uncanny verisimilitude to the already astoundingly-detailed product.
